Dominant Rebel sides hoping for double delight in Portlaoise
Mossie Barrett’s junior football charges are first into action against Louth at 3pm and they are on the back of excellent form in Munster when they dismissed of the challenges of Waterford, Kerry and Clare. Their defence is backboned by Enda Wiseman and Richard O’Sullivan, while Andrew O’Sullivan and Chris O’Donovan form a powerful midfield pairing. In attack the scoring onus will be on Daniel O’Donovan, Colm O’Driscoll and Robert O’Mahony. But centre-forward Cathrach Keane looks set to be absent after suffering a serious knee injury in action for Carbery on Thursday night.
Louth beat Longford by five points in the Leinster final and will look to former senior Colin Goss at full-back and forward duo Kevin Rogers and Hugh McGinn for inspiration.
